Starting on Friday 27th February 2009 for 3 days, myself and a group of car enthusiasts will set off from John O'Groats to Lands End to raise money for the Parkinson's Disease Society. The reason i've chosen this charity is that one of my grandparents who had this disease sadly passed away in April 2007. Like all grandparents, he meant alot to me, my family and all his friends.
The reason that we're doing it in something as modern as the car opposite, is that he was an engineer. He was always fascinated by modern design and he loved cars. I think this would be a fitting tribute to a man that meant so much to so many.
